**Q: A visitor shows up at the front desk — what do I do?**

Easy: sign them into the Greetly log, give them a red lanyard, and ping their host. Visitors can't roam unescorted past the atrium at Pellmont Tower. If the host is slow, park them in the lounge. To buzz them through the inner door, use the code below.

door code, kawip-bagap: bdg-HQEWH-4

## Runbook: TideGlass widget stale-data recovery

Context for the weekly sync: the TideGlass tide-table widget caches predictions from the Harborline forecast service for six hours. If users in the Pellwick region report tables frozen on yesterday's cycle, first confirm the cache daemon is alive, then check whether the upstream ingest marked the last pull as partial. A partial pull must be re-fetched manually before invalidating the cache, or the widget will render empty columns. Record which deployment you touched by capturing the token below.

pipeline stamp: htk9_6ce9d33c5

**Ticket: Vault locked — Thornfield catalogue import blocked**

Priority: High. The Marginalia import job for the Thornfield library catalogue failed at 02:10 because the credentials vault auto-locked after three bad attempts from the retry loop. Import is stalled at batch 14 of 62. Release is blocked until the vault reopens. Fix applied to the retry loop; needs redeploy. To unlock manually, open the vault console on the batch host and enter the recovery passphrase, provided below.

unlock words, tawif-tahop: oliys-ulawyn-tamdor-lamys-casox-jormir-fraius-kasath-ulador-ulamir-holir-sorys-holeth

Good question — when two devices edit the same event offline, SyncGrove keeps both versions rather than guessing, then flags them for merge. From a security standpoint, nothing leaks: conflict copies inherit the original event's ACLs, and the merge log is append-only. If the merge service itself gets locked out mid-reconciliation (rare, but it happens after a forced credential rotation), recovery is manual. To reopen the sealed merge journal, enter the passphrase provided just below.

vault phrase of tajef-tafog = istox-sorax-zorox-casok-holox-kelix-weneth-drueth-casion